Legal Intern - Fall 2026
Lambda · San Francisco, California, United States
Pay
$38–48/hr
Setting
Hybrid
Lambda, The Superintelligence Cloud, is a leader in AI cloud infrastructure serving tens of thousands of customers. Our customers range from AI researchers to enterprises and hyperscalers. Lambda's mission is to make compute as ubiquitous as electricity and give everyone the power of superintelligence. One person, one GPU.
If you'd like to build the world's best AI cloud, join us.
Join Lambda's Legal team as a generalist intern, gaining hands-on in-house experience across Commercial and Corporate matters at a fast-paced AI infrastructure company. You'll work directly on a variety of commercial agreements (customer, vendor, NDA, and more) alongside corporate transactions like M&A, financing, and public company readiness. Beyond supporting the team's active transaction pipeline, you'll take ownership of several concrete projects designed to modernize how the team reviews and manages contracts.
What You’ll Do
- Opportunity to get hands-on experience working in-house as a generalist supporting the Commercial and Corporate Legal teams at a fast-paced AI infrastructure company.
- You will be a generalist supporting the team on many exciting transactions we have in the pipeline but some additional specific projects we have in mind:
- Draft and validate an NDA and vendor-agreement triage playbook with clear GREEN/YELLOW/RED classification criteria and escalation paths
- Build and annotate a clause and template library reflecting Lambda's standard and fallback contract positions
- Use Claude or other AI tools to build and test an intake workflow that produces first-pass issue-spot summaries for counsel review
- Draft a library of response templates for routine counterparty negotiation asks
- Assist with onboarding the company on a new contract lifecycle management (CLM) platform
You
- Currently pursuing a JD (2L or 3L preferred)
- Have completed contracts coursework, with strong legal writing and analytical skills
- Are comfortable working with AI-assisted tools such as Claude, or eager to learn them
- Ability to work at least 1 day per week in our San Francisco office
Nice to Have
- Prior internship at a law firm or in-house legal team
- Experience with corporate and securities law and/or commercial or technology agreements
- Familiarity with contract lifecycle or legal workflow tools

Senior FP&A Analyst - Engineering & Product
Lambda · San Francisco, California, United States
Pay
$169k–200k
Setting
Hybrid
Lambda, The Superintelligence Cloud, is a leader in AI cloud infrastructure serving tens of thousands of customers. Our customers range from AI researchers to enterprises and hyperscalers. Lambda's mission is to make compute as ubiquitous as electricity and give everyone the power of superintelligence. One person, one GPU.
If you'd like to build the world's best AI cloud, join us.
*Note: This position requires presence in our San Francisco or San Jose office location 4 days per week; Lambda's designated work from home day is currently Tuesday.
What You'll Do
Project Spend, Internal Capacity & Fleet Optimization
- Own project-level budgets, spend tracking, and cost-to-complete forecasts for Engineering and Product initiatives
- Quantify internal capacity consumption across development, testing, and benchmarking; build and maintain allocation and chargeback methodology
- Partner with Infrastructure and Engineering on fleet optimization, including utilization, idle capacity, instance mix, and reclamation opportunities
- Translate optimization opportunities into quantified savings and track realization against target
Product Investment ROI & R&D Analysis
- Build business cases and ROI models for product and R&D investments
- Establish post-investment measurement; track realized returns against the original underwriting
- Analyze R&D spend by initiative and support capitalization analysis with Accounting
- Provide prioritization frameworks and trade-off analysis for competing investment requests
New Product Introduction (NPI) Management
- Serve as the finance partner across the NPI lifecycle, from concept through launch and ramp
- Model pricing, unit economics, margin, and volume assumptions for new offerings
- Own stage-gate financial deliverables and launch readiness criteria
- Track post-launch performance against the launch case and inform go/no-go and scaling decisions
Engineering & Product Headcount and OpEx Management (BvA)
- Own OpEx and headcount planning, tracking, and reporting for the Engineering, Product, and Cloud Services organizations
- Maintain hiring plans, compensation assumptions, and organizational change tracking against approved headcount
- Prepare monthly and quarterly budget vs. actual analysis, identify key drivers, and partner with Engineering and Product leaders to explain performance
- Manage vendor, software, and tooling spend; support accrual and reclassification inputs with Accounting through the monthly close
Cash Flow Forecasting
- Build and maintain the operating cash flow forecast model, including timing of vendor payments, capacity commitments, and project spend
- Own the rolling near-term cash view; reconcile forecast to actuals and explain variances
- Model scenarios around deployment timing, payment terms, and financing structures
- Partner with Accounting and Treasury on payables timing, prepaids, and commitment schedules
Executive Reporting & Communication
- Deliver Cloud Services, Engineering, and Product insights for monthly business reviews, executive reviews, and board materials
- Translate complex technical and operational data into clear financial insight
- Provide actionable recommendations on cost efficiency, investment prioritization, and margin improvement
You
- Have a bachelor's degree in Finance, Accounting, Economics, or a related field
- Have 4+ years experience in FP&A, corporate finance, investment banking, or consulting, ideally with a focus on Cloud / AI infrastructure, SaaS, Data centers, Telecom, Hardware, or industrials
- Have direct experience partnering with Engineering or Product organizations on budget, roadmap, and investment decisions
- Possess extensive experience in financial modeling and analysis, with a deep expertise in constructing complex financial models and interpreting financial statements to drive strategic decision-making
- Have excellent analytical, strategic thinking, and decision-making skills
- Possess strong Excel skills and experience with financial software systems
- Have the ability to thrive in a fast-paced, high-growth environment, balancing multiple complex projects
- Have excellent written and verbal communication skills with the ability to present complex data clearly and concisely
- Are a team player with a positive attitude, strong work ethic, and a commitment to continuous improvement
- Are able to work in an ambiguous environment with very little direction
Nice to Have
- Prior experience in a startup or high-growth organization, demonstrating adaptability and flexibility to thrive in such environments
- Direct experience building or owning a cash flow forecast
- Experience with R&D capitalization, new product introduction, or product P&L ownership
- Working proficiency in SQL and comfort querying large data sets directly
- Familiarity with GPU compute, AI/ML workloads, or cloud infrastructure economics

Technical Accounting/SEC Reporting Lead
Lambda · San Jose, California, United States
Pay
$169k–225k
Setting
Hybrid
Lambda, The Superintelligence Cloud, is a leader in AI cloud infrastructure serving tens of thousands of customers. Our customers range from AI researchers to enterprises and hyperscalers. Lambda's mission is to make compute as ubiquitous as electricity and give everyone the power of superintelligence. One person, one GPU.
If you'd like to build the world's best AI cloud, join us.
*Note: This position requires presence in our San Jose office location 4 days per week; Lambda’s designated work from home day is currently Tuesday.
What You’ll Do
- Lead technical accounting research and prepare memos for complex, non-routine transactions in accordance with U.S. GAAP
- Analyze accounting implications of significant transactions, including revenue, equity, debt, business combinations, leases, and stock-based compensation
- Partner cross-functionally (Legal, Tax, FP&A, Treasury) to assess accounting impacts and provide guidance ahead of execution
- Develop and maintain accounting policies; evaluate and implement new FASB and SEC guidance in preparation for public company readiness
- Support IPO readiness efforts, including drafting technical disclosures, assisting with S-1/10-K preparation, and enhancing financial statement presentation
- Assist with consolidated financial statement preparation, footnotes, and reporting package reviews to ensure accuracy and SEC compliance
- Support external audits and SOX readiness by preparing documentation, strengthening controls, and improving close and reporting processes
- Contribute to M&A, system implementations, and other strategic initiatives to support company growth
What we look for in you:
- Bachelor’s degree in Accounting, Finance, or related field
- 4+ years of experience in technical accounting, preferably within a Big 4 firm and/or a publicly traded company
- Active CPA required
- Strong knowledge of the U.S. GAAP with experience analyzing complex and non-routine transactions (e.g., revenue recognition, leases, equity, debt, business combinations)
- Proven ability to research accounting guidance and prepare clear, well-supported technical accounting memos
- Understanding of SEC reporting and disclosure requirements
- Experience partnering cross-functionally to assess accounting implications of business initiatives
- Familiarity with ERP and reporting tools (e.g., NetSuite, Workiva)
- Advanced Excel skills and strong analytical capabilities
- Excellent written and verbal communication skills, with the ability to translate technical guidance into practical recommendations
- Detail-oriented, proactive, and comfortable operating in a fast-paced environment
Nice to haves:
- Big 4 audit or accounting advisory experience with strong technical accounting expertise
- Deep knowledge of ASC 606 (revenue), ASC 842 (leases), and ASC 718 (stock-based compensation), including memo preparation and policy development
- Experience with pre-IPO technical matters, including equity instruments, preferred stock, warrants, EPS, and SEC reporting considerations
- Strong understanding of the U.S. GAAP financial reporting, including preparation and review of financial statements and footnote disclosures
- Experience supporting IPO readiness, S-1/10-K preparation, and PCAOB audits
- Background in high-growth, pre-IPO or public technology companies (SaaS/AI preferred)
- Exposure to M&A and purchase accounting, particularly in revenue and equity-related areas
- Demonstrated ability to strengthen controls and build scalable accounting processes in fast-paced environments

Manager, Investor Relations
Lambda · San Francisco, California, United States
Pay
$150k–200k
Setting
Hybrid
Lambda, The Superintelligence Cloud, is a leader in AI cloud infrastructure serving tens of thousands of customers. Our customers range from AI researchers to enterprises and hyperscalers. Lambda's mission is to make compute as ubiquitous as electricity and give everyone the power of superintelligence. One person, one GPU.
If you'd like to build the world's best AI cloud, join us.
*Note: This position requires presence in our San Francisco or San Jose office location 4 days per week; Lambda’s designated work from home day is currently Tuesday.
About the Role
We are seeking a Manager, Investor Relations to strengthen the analytical and strategic core of our Investor Relations function as the company scales. This is a senior role for someone who can independently own complex analysis and judgment-based work, not simply support it, while also developing the junior analyst who reports to them.
Reporting to and partnering closely with the Vice President of Investor Relations, this role works across Finance, FP&A, Capital Markets & Corporate Development, and the broader organization to help management understand external expectations, investor sentiment, and market dynamics. The ideal candidate combines strong financial acumen, analytical rigor, and sharp communication skills with a genuine interest in how sophisticated investors evaluate businesses.
Prior investor relations experience is welcome but not required, and it is not what we are optimizing for. We care far more about analytical horsepower, sound judgment, and a strong point of view, paired with the eagerness to learn our approach to investor relations.
This is a highly visible role with regular exposure to executive leadership, investors, analysts, and the broader financial community. The [Senior] Manager will have one direct report, an Investor Relations Analyst. While the focus of the role is the work itself rather than people management, prior management experience is not required; what matters is the desire to guide, develop, and elevate a junior team member.
What You’ll Do
- Own earnings preparation. Lead the development of earnings materials, including presentations, scripts, Q&A, and supporting analyses, working with the VP to ensure accuracy, consistency, and a compelling narrative.
- Read the market. Develop a deep, ongoing understanding of investor sentiment, analyst expectations, and market perception, and translate it into clear insights for management.
- Analyze and interpret. Assess investor feedback, analyst research, peer disclosures, and industry developments to identify implications for our communications and positioning.
- Act as a thought partner. Serve as a trusted analytical partner to the VP of Investor Relations on investor sentiment, market expectations, competitive positioning, and external perception.
- Bridge FP&A and IR. Partner closely with FP&A to understand operating performance, forecast assumptions, and key business drivers, and translate internal operating trends into investor-relevant insights.
- Partner with Capital Markets and Corporate Development. Coordinate closely with Capital Markets & Corporate Development on all capital-raising activity, focusing on consistency of metrics and narrative across external communications.
- Anticipate the Street. Analyze the relationship between company performance and investor expectations to help management anticipate investor questions, reactions, and areas of focus.
- Surface disconnects. Identify gaps between internal expectations and external models, and recommend approaches to messaging, disclosure, and investor engagement.
- Develop the analyst. Guide and develop the Investor Relations Analyst (a direct report), reviewing their work and helping raise the analytical quality of the function’s output.
You
- 4+ years of experience in equity research, investment banking, management consulting, strategic finance, investor relations, or a similarly analytical field. Prior investor relations experience is welcome but not required.
- Strong command of financial statements, operating metrics, valuation frameworks, and public company disclosures.
- Strong analytical and financial modeling capabilities.
- Demonstrated ability to synthesize complex financial and market information into clear, actionable insights and recommendations.
- Exceptional written and verbal communication skills, with the judgment to know what matters to a sophisticated audience.
- Intellectual curiosity and a genuine interest in markets, investors, competitors, and business performance.
- A genuine desire to mentor and develop a direct report while remaining hands-on in the work; prior people-management experience is not required.
Nice to Have
- Experience with companies that need to raise significant amounts of capital, or with capital-intensive businesses.
- Experience with highly technical or complex business models.
- A track record of advancement within a single firm rather than frequent job changes; we value depth and demonstrated growth in one place.
- Familiarity with AI, cloud infrastructure, or adjacent technology sectors.
Success in This Role
Success in this role is about owning your work end-to-end. You produce solid, reliable analysis, you know exactly where every number came from, and you are seen across the organization as someone whose work can be trusted without a second check. It is about consistently doing rigorous, dependable work that others can build on with confidence.

Staff Connectivity Engineer
Lambda · San Jose, California, United States
Pay
$349k–465k
Setting
Hybrid
Lambda, The Superintelligence Cloud, is a leader in AI cloud infrastructure serving tens of thousands of customers. Our customers range from AI researchers to enterprises and hyperscalers. Lambda's mission is to make compute as ubiquitous as electricity and give everyone the power of superintelligence. One person, one GPU.
If you'd like to build the world's best AI cloud, join us.
*Note: This position requires presence in our San Francisco or San Jose office location 4 days per week; Lambda’s designated work from home day is currently Tuesday.
As a Staff Connectivity Infrastructure Engineer, you will drive and support the Physical Infrastructure Cabling Standards (PICS) across all of Lambda’s global data centers. Reporting directly to the Principal of Data Center Architecture and Standards, you will focus on developing and implementing connectivity components and infrastructure solutions that support our demanding GPU Cluster deployments, while accelerating deployment timelines, simplifying operations and reducing costs - all while meeting stringent performance expectations. You will also lead New Product Implementation (NPI) efforts for PICS and be responsible for documenting all Standard Operating Procedures (SOPs) and Methods of Procedure (MOPs) for solutions deployed within our data center infrastructure, including colocation white-space fit-outs, equipment installations, and upgrade initiatives.
What You’ll Do
Documentation & Standards Management
- Develop and maintain all PICS (Physical Infrastructure Cabling Standards) documentation, including Basis of Design (BoD) specifications, component-level details, and operational and installation SOP/MOP’s.
- Ensure adherence to PICS Standards enabling optimal connectivity performance, scalability, flexibility and continuity within our entire global DC Infrastructure fleet.
- Develop and publish dashboards that broadcast our business operations, key Metrics & KPI’s, Project status and issues that impact our area can be resolved quickly and effectively.
Cross-Functional Team & Vendor Management Support
- Serve as the primary PICS subject-matter expert for Internal Teams — providing guidance and support to our HPC Architecture, Hardware & Network Engineering, PMO, Supply Chain and Data Center Operations Teams.
- Build and maintain strong relationships with Manufacturers and Suppliers to help ensure supply chain continuity, cost effectiveness and quality assurance.
- Review and develop the detailed BOM’s with Suppliers to ensure our components are built to PICS Standards and they meet our exact connectivity specification requirements.
Innovation, NPI & Industry Alignment
- Stay current with industry trends, emerging cabling technologies, and new data center infrastructure solutions.
- Encourage the adoption of new technologies and keen practices that can improve upon PICS and keep us at the forefront of industry trends.
- Drive the development, qualification, and implementation of new connectivity products and standards into production (NPI).
Project & Deployment Support
- Participate in design reviews and page-turn sessions, providing technical guidance for cabling infrastructure specifications in new data center builds.
- Assist in deploying connectivity components and PICS standards across global data center projects.
- Conduct regular site visits to assess construction progress, document findings, and resolve PICS-related issues.
Quality, Compliance & Continuous Improvement
- Ensure consistent quality of installations and infrastructure by performing QC/QA to PICS best practices across global deployments.
- Track costs, time to install, capacity utilization and connectivity performance to identify methods to optimize efficiency and effectiveness and reduce costs.
- Contribute to process-improvement initiatives and participate in team knowledge-sharing to advance operating efficiency and alignment with industry best practices.
You
- 10+ years of experience in Data Center cabling infrastructure engineering, connectivity architecture and physical layer design.
- Deep knowledge of fiber-optic and copper cabling systems, termination methods, cable plant architecture, and high-density interconnect solutions.
- Hands-on experience developing installation standards, component specifications, and cabling architectures for hyperscale or large enterprise environments.
- Strong vendor, OEM, and supply chain engagement experience.
- Ability to lead highly technical, cross-functional initiatives involving engineering, construction, and operations.
- Strong documentation, analytical, and communication skills.
- Familiarity with industry standards (TIA/EIA, BICSI, IEC).
- Ability to read, create, and modify technical drawings (AutoCAD, Revit, Bluebeam, or equivalent).
Nice to Have
- Experience with AI/HPC cluster architectures and GPU-dense deployments.
- Background in NPI, qualification testing, or component engineering.
- Industry certifications (e.g., RCDD, DCDC, CFHP, BICSI).
- Experience with optical test equipment, inspection, and fiber QA workflows.
- Ability to influence stakeholders and drive customer-focused outcomes across global programs.
